Well, you don’t see this too often these days in the superhero genre. Disney’s biggest success besides Deadpool and Wolverine this year is Agatha All Along, its Disney Plus series that managed to be one of its best. Now, its star is being recognized at the Golden Globes.

Agatha herself, Kathryn Hahn, has been nominated for Best Actress in a Television Series, Musical or Comedy. Agatha All Along is certainly a comedy, but there was of course some particular emphasis on a specific song.

Hahn was incredible as Agatha, hilarious one moment, but emotionally gripping the next. The nomination is certainly well deserved. Her competition in the category is:

Ayo Edebiri (The Bear)
Jean Smart (Hacks)
Kirsten Bell (Nobody Wants This)
Quinta Brunson (Abbot Elementary)
Selena Gomez (Only Murders in the Building)

It’s a stacked category, certainly, and a win for Hahn would be tough. She’s up against Jean Smart who just won an Emmy for Hacks, and she may be destined to repeat that at the Golden Globes here.

Fans have wanted to see a season 2 of Agatha All Along, but it’s unclear if that will happen, as both A) the show was meant to be a miniseries and B) if (and when) Agatha does return, it may be in another production, like a Wiccan series or Scarlet Witch movie.

But Hahn is clear about wanting to play the part again, as she reiterated after her nomination, after previously saying that it was a good way to “say goodbye.”

“I think I meant that we were very satisfied by the way that Agatha All Along ended the arc of that story being told there,” she clarified to Deadline.

“I think everyone would be thrilled to come back, of course, in any capacity. It was a very life altering, deep experience in Atlanta, Georgia, with just this very small cast on the soundstage, day after day after day… I’m so proud, and I’m so thrilled for Marvel. They were so supportive of this tiny, fabulous, female- and queer-led show.”

The nomination certainly could help the prospects of a season 2, though again, it’s possibly that Disney may just want Hahn to return for a new series with linked characters to Agatha All Along. That would be a very Disney thing to do, albeit the higher-ups have recently said they wanted more multi-season series structured like actual TV shows. And Agatha was indeed structured like an actual TV show, rather than a chopped up movie.

Whatever the case, we will no doubt see Hahn as Agatha again. I hope she wins at the Golden Globes.
